Thanks, it seems that Hyperconnect can load data but it doesn't do whatt Anaplan Connect does meaning it can't launch actions within a model as they are the same source as target.
I have a Process within a single model to import data from module 1 to module 2 in the same model....there is no 2nd model. Is there a way to just kick off that Process with Hyperconnect?
You may have to load a dummy file and use that as your source in order to create a process calling the model to model import action (module to module is still considered model to model even when the source model is the same).
